What is a Registered Agent?
An agent that is registered stands as an designated entity and company which is empowered for handle legal papers representing a business. This comprises vital files like process serving, tax documents, as well as compliance filings. Each business entity, such as LLCs along with corporate entities, is required to possess an agent that is registered for its location where it operates or carries out activities. This ensures that there is point of contact regarding legal matters.
In Washington, a registered business agent must maintain a actual address inside that region. This means that Post Office Box cannot as a registered agent's contact. The agent should remain accessible in standard operating hours to receive any documents which could be delivered for the firm. Possessing a registered business agent in the state of Washington helps ensure that remains compliant to state laws while can respond promptly for potential legal challenges that could happen.

Ways to Appoint Your Registered Agent
Designating a registered agent in Washington is a crucial step for business owners when forming a startup. The registered agent is in charge of receiving important legal documents and government notices on for your business. To start, you must ensure that your selected agent meets the state requirements, including being a inhabitant of the state or a corporation licensed to conduct business in the state. This ensures that your registered agent is accessible and recognized by law.
When you have identified a suitable individual or company, you can select them as your registered agent by providing their data on your company formation documents. This typically includes the agent's name and address. If you are using a service, ensure that the registered agent service you choose is reputable and has a reliable track record. It is crucial to ensure that the agent you choose knows their duties, including prompt handling of correspondence and notifications.
In conclusion, note that designating a registered agent is not a one-time task. If you decide to switch your registered agent in the upcoming period, you will need to submit the appropriate forms with the Secretary of State of Washington. This process can vary depending on whether you are changing to a different agent or modifying the address of your current agent. Regularly review your registered agent situation to ensure adherence and convenience for your enterprise.
Common Myths Concerning Registered Agents
Many founders erroneously think that a registered agent is merely a formality for their business registration. Although registered agent compliance is accurate that each business entity in Washington must appoint a registered agent, this role comes with important responsibilities. A registered agent is not merely a mailbox; they serve as the primary contact person for legal documents and government notices, which can be critical for ensuring compliance and dealing with legal issues in a timely manner.
One more common misconception is that any person can serve as a registered agent.
